网络配置方法、装置、设备和系统制造方法及图纸

技术编号:26535277 阅读:43 留言:0更新日期:2020-12-01 14:25
本发明专利技术实施例提供一种网络配置方法、装置、设备和系统,该方法包括:响应于配网触发操作,配网设备侦听待入网设备发出的包含待入网设备的属性信息的管理帧,根据管理帧中包含的属性信息从服务器中获取待入网设备对应的密钥;根据获得的密钥加密路由器的网络配置信息;将加密后的网络配置信息发送至待入网设备,以使待入网设备根据网络配置信息接入路由器。通过将待入网设备配置为在需要进行网络配置时,广播包含其属性信息的管理帧,以使得配网设备能够自动获取待入网设备的属性信息,无需人工干预,可以有助于对待入网设备进行网络配置的效率。

【技术实现步骤摘要】
网络配置方法、装置、设备和系统
本专利技术涉及互联网/物联网
,尤其涉及一种网络配置方法、装置、设备和系统。
技术介绍
为保证诸如智能插座、智能空调、智能空气净化器等智能设备的正常使用,首先需要将这些智能设备连接入网,进而才能对这些智能设备进行远程控制。由于这些智能设备没有人机交互界面,不能像电脑、手机一样的搜索/选择指定路由器以及输入接入密码的界面,从而不能自主地完成网络配置,因此,需要解决为诸如智能插座、智能空调等待入网设备进行自动地网络配置的问题。
技术实现思路
本专利技术实施例提供一种网络配置方法、装置、设备和系统,用以实现配网设备对待入网设备的自动网络配置。第一方面,本专利技术实施例提供一种网络配置方法,应用于配网设备,包括:响应于配网触发操作,侦听待入网设备发出的包含所述待入网设备的属性信息的管理帧;根据所述属性信息从服务器中获取所述待入网设备对应的密钥;根据所述密钥加密路由器的网络配置信息;将加密后的网络配置信息发送至所述待入网设备,以使所述待入网设备根据所述网络配置信息接入所述路由器。第二方面,本专利技术实施例提供一种网络配置装置,位于配网设备中,包括:获取模块,用于响应于配网触发操作,侦听待入网设备发出的包含所述待入网设备的属性信息的管理帧,根据所述属性信息从服务器中获取所述待入网设备对应的密钥;加密模块,用于根据所述密钥加密路由器的网络配置信息;发送模块,用于将加密后的网络配置信息发送至所述待入网设备,以使所述待入网设备根据所述网络配置信息接入所述路由器。第三方面,本专利技术实施例提供一种配网设备,该配网设备包括第一处理器和第一存储器,其中,所述第一存储器上存储有可执行代码,当所述可执行代码被所述第一处理器执行时,使所述第一处理器执行第一方面中的网络配置方法。本专利技术实施例提供了一种非暂时性机器可读存储介质,所述非暂时性机器可读存储介质上存储有可执行代码,当所述可执行代码被配网设备的处理器执行时,使所述处理器执行第一方面中的网络配置方法。第四方面,本专利技术实施例提供一种网络配置方法,应用于待入网设备,所述方法包括:发送包含待入网设备的属性信息的管理帧,以使配网设备根据侦听到的所述管理帧中包含的所述属性信息从服务器中获取所述待入网设备对应的密钥;接收配网设备发送的加密的网络配置信息;解密获得所述网络配置信息;根据所述网络配置信息接入对应的路由器。第五方面,本专利技术实施例提供一种网络配置装置,位于待入网设备中,包括:发送模块,用于发送包含待入网设备的属性信息的管理帧,以使配网设备根据侦听到的所述管理帧中包含的所述属性信息从服务器中获取所述待入网设备对应的密钥;接收模块,用于接收配网设备发送的加密的网络配置信息;解密模块,用于解密获得所述网络配置信息;连接模块,用于根据所述网络配置信息接入对应的路由器。第六方面,本专利技术实施例提供一种待入网设备,包括第二处理器和第二存储器,其中,所述第二存储器上存储有可执行代码,当所述可执行代码被所述第二处理器执行时,使所述第二处理器执行第四方面中的网络配置方法。本专利技术实施例提供了一种非暂时性机器可读存储介质,所述非暂时性机器可读存储介质上存储有可执行代码,当所述可执行代码被待入网设备的处理器执行时,使所述处理器执行第四方面中的网络配置方法。第七方面,本专利技术实施例提供一种网络配置系统,包括:配网设备、待入网设备、服务器;所述待入网设备,用于发送包含所述待入网设备的属性信息的管理帧,以及接收所述配网设备发送的加密的网络配置信息,解密获得所述网络配置信息,根据所述网络配置信息接入对应的路由器;所述配网设备,用于响应于配网触发操作,侦听所述管理帧,根据所述属性信息向服务器发送密钥获取请求,根据获取到的所述待入网设备对应的密钥加密所述路由器的网络配置信息,将加密后的网络配置信息发送至所述待入网设备;所述服务器,用于响应于所述密钥获取请求,将所述待入网设备对应的密钥发送至所述配网设备。当通过配网设备对待入网设备进行网络配置以使得待入网设备通过接入路由器以联网时,需要配网设备将路由器的接入密码等网络配置信息发送至待入网设备。但是,由于网络配置信息中会包括诸如接入密码等敏感的需要保密的信息,因此,这些信息在传输过程中需要被加密发送,因而,配网设备需要获取待入网设备对应的密钥,以便使用该密钥对网络配置信息的全部或部分敏感信息进行加密。而配网设备获取待入网设备对应的密钥,具体是以待入网设备的属性信息作为关键词来查询服务器,以从服务器获得待入网设备对应的密钥。为了实现整个网络配置过程的自动化,无需人为干预,以提高网络配置的效率,在本专利技术实施例中,当需要配网设备对待入网设备进行网络配置时,待入网设备被配置为向外广播发送特定的管理帧,该管理帧中包含待入网设备的属性信息。从而,如果配网设备侦听到该管理帧,则可以从该管理帧中解析出待入网设备的属性信息,从而实现待入网设备的属性信息的自动获取,无需人为干预。之后,配网设备基于该属性信息从服务器获得待入网设备对应的密钥,对网络配置信息进行加密,将加密的网络配置信息发送至待入网设备,以供待入网设备解密得到网络配置信息,基于网络配置信息接入对应的路由器。由此可知,通过将待入网设备配置为在需要进行网络配置时,广播包含其属性信息的管理帧,以使得配网设备能够自动获取待入网设备的属性信息,无需人工干预,可以有助于对待入网设备进行网络配置的效率。附图说明为了更清楚地说明本专利技术实施例或现有技术中的技术方案,下面将对实施例或现有技术描述中所需要使用的附图作一简单地介绍,显而易见地,下面描述中的附图是本专利技术的一些实施例,对于本领域普通技术人员来讲,在不付出创造性劳动的前提下,还可以根据这些附图获得其他的附图。图1为本专利技术实施例提供的网络配置系统的一种工作流程示意图;图2为本专利技术实施例提供的网络配置系统的另一种工作流程示意图;图3为本专利技术实施例提供的网络配置系统的又一种工作流程示意图;图4为本专利技术实施例提供的一种网络配置装置的结构示意图;图5为与图4所示实施例提供的网络配置装置对应的配网设备的结构示意图;图6为本专利技术实施例提供的另一种网络配置装置的结构示意图;图7为与图6所示实施例提供的网络配置装置对应的待入网设备的结构示意图。具体实施方式为使本专利技术实施例的目的、技术方案和优点更加清楚,下面将结合本专利技术实施例中的附图,对本专利技术实施例中的技术方案进行清楚、完整地描述,显然,所描述的实施例是本专利技术一部分实施例,而不是全部的实施例。基于本专利技术中的实施例,本领域普通技术人员在没有作出创造性劳动前提下所获得的所有其他实施例,都属于本专利技术保护的范围。在本专利技术实施例中使用的术语是仅仅出于描述特定实施例的目的,而非旨在限制本专利技术。在本专利技术实施例和所附权利要求书中本文档来自技高网...

【技术保护点】
1.一种网络配置方法,其特征在于,应用于配网设备,所述方法包括:/n响应于配网触发操作,侦听待入网设备发出的包含所述待入网设备的属性信息的管理帧;/n根据所述属性信息从服务器中获取所述待入网设备对应的密钥;/n根据所述密钥加密路由器的网络配置信息;/n将加密后的网络配置信息发送至所述待入网设备,以使所述待入网设备根据所述网络配置信息接入所述路由器。/n

【技术特征摘要】
1.一种网络配置方法,其特征在于,应用于配网设备,所述方法包括:
响应于配网触发操作,侦听待入网设备发出的包含所述待入网设备的属性信息的管理帧;
根据所述属性信息从服务器中获取所述待入网设备对应的密钥;
根据所述密钥加密路由器的网络配置信息;
将加密后的网络配置信息发送至所述待入网设备,以使所述待入网设备根据所述网络配置信息接入所述路由器。


2.根据权利要求1所述的方法,其特征在于,所述管理帧中包含设定标志位,所述设定标志位用于标识所述管理帧用于传输所述属性信息。


3.根据权利要求1所述的方法,其特征在于,所述管理帧为信标帧,所述属性信息填充在所述信标帧的服务集标识字段中,或者,所述属性信息填充在所述信标帧中除所述服务集标识字段外的其他字段中。


4.根据权利要求1所述的方法,其特征在于,所述管理帧为探测请求帧或探测应答帧。


5.根据权利要求1所述的方法,其特征在于,所述方法还包括:
若在设定时间内未侦听到所述管理帧,则输出提示信息,所述提示信息用于提示以备选方式获取所述属性信息。


6.根据权利要求5所述的方法,其特征在于,所述方法还包括:
扫描所述待入网设备对应的标识码以获得所述属性信息,所述标识码中包含所述属性信息。


7.根据权利要求5所述的方法,其特征在于,所述方法还包括:
显示产品类目列表,所述产品类目列表中包括多种产品类目信息;
确定从所述多种产品类目信息中选择的与所述待入网设备对应的目标产品类目信息作为所述属性信息。


8.根据权利要求1至7中任一项所述的方法,其特征在于,所述属性信息中至少包括所述待入网设备对应的产品类目信息;
所述根据所述属性信息从服务器中获取所述待入网设备对应的密钥,包括:
根据所述产品类目信息从服务器中获取所述待入网设备对应的密钥。


9.根据权利要求8所述的方法,其特征在于,所述属性信息中还包括:所述待入网设备对应的配网模式和/或配网工具包的版本号;
所述将加密后的网络配置信息发送至所述待入网设备,包括:
根据所述配网模式和/或配网工具包的版本号,确定采用的配网协议;
根据所述配网协议将加密后的网络配置信息发送至所述待入网设备。


10.一种网络配置方法,其特征在于,应用于待入网设备,所述方法包括:
发送包含待入网设备的属性信息的管理帧,以使配网设备根据侦听到的所述管理帧中包含的所述属性信息从服务器中获取所述待入网设备对应的密钥;
接收配网设备发送的加密的网络配置信息;
解密获得所述网络配置信息;
根据所述网络配置信息接入对应的路由器。


11.根据权利要求10所述的方法,其特征在于,所述管理帧中包含设定标志位,所述设定标志位用于标识所述管理帧用于传输所述属性信息。


12.根据权利要求10所述的方法,其特征在于,所述管理帧为信标帧,所述属性信息填充在所述信标帧的服务集标识字段中,或者,所述属性信息填充在所述信标帧中除所述服务集标识字段外的其他字段中。


13.根据权利要求10所述的方法,其特征在于,所述管理帧为探测请求帧或探测应答帧。


14.根据权利要求10所述的方法,其特征在于,所述发送包含待入网设备的属性信息的管理帧,包括:
在设定时间内循环发送所述...

【专利技术属性】
技术研发人员:张畋游松杨骁
申请(专利权)人:阿里巴巴集团控股有限公司
类型:发明
国别省市:开曼群岛;KY

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1